mirror of
https://github.com/Xahau/xahau.js.git
synced 2025-11-21 20:55:48 +00:00
Fix endless loop when creating an Account object for a non-existent account.
This commit is contained in:
@@ -163,7 +163,10 @@ Account.prototype.getNextSequence = function(callback) {
|
|||||||
var callback = typeof callback === 'function' ? callback : function(){};
|
var callback = typeof callback === 'function' ? callback : function(){};
|
||||||
|
|
||||||
function accountInfo(err, info) {
|
function accountInfo(err, info) {
|
||||||
if (err) {
|
if (err && err.error === "actNotFound") {
|
||||||
|
// New accounts will start out as sequence zero
|
||||||
|
callback(null, 0);
|
||||||
|
} else if (err) {
|
||||||
callback(err);
|
callback(err);
|
||||||
} else {
|
} else {
|
||||||
callback(null, info.account_data.Sequence);
|
callback(null, info.account_data.Sequence);
|
||||||
|
|||||||
Reference in New Issue
Block a user